GDZ Informatika 6 osztály. Pidruchnik [Rivkind I.Ya., Lisenko T.I., Chernіkova L.A., Shakotko V.V.] 2019
31.01.2020,
6 Клас / Інформатика,
3 524,
0
3.4. Beágyazott hurkok és ágak
Válaszolj a kérdésre
1. Milyen ciklust nevezünk beágyazott ágnak?
Az ágak, beleértve a beágyazott ágakat is, nemcsak egy ciklusba léphetnek be egy számlálóval, hanem egy ciklusba is egy feltétellel. Az előző bekezdésben megvizsgálta a probléma-játék algoritmust, amikor a számítógép "kitalálta" a számot, és a hallgató megpróbálta kitalálni. Ebben az algoritmusban azonban, ha a hallgató az első kísérlet során nem találta ki a számot, akkor a játék véget ért.
Az 1. feladatban a hiányos elágazás be van ágyazva egy számlálóval ellátott hurokba. A hurok tartalmazhat beágyazott teljes ágakat is. Az előző bekezdésben megvizsgálta a riasztás beállításának algoritmusát. De a riasztást többször is be kell állítania, de a hét minden napján.
2. Milyen ágakat nevezzünk egy hurokban beágyazottnak?
Az elágazási ciklusok használhatók a 2. Scratchban. Íme egy példa egy olyan projektre, amelyben az előadó elmozdul a jelenet jobb szélétől, ha megérinti, vagy rajzol egy négyzetet, ha nem érinti a határt.
Az ágak be lehet ágyazva egy hurokba. Az algoritmus azon töredékét mutatjuk be, amelyben a teljes elágazás be van ágyazva a hurokba a számlálóval, és a 3.43. Ábrán látható az algoritmus azon töredéke, amelyben a teljes elágazás be van ágyazva a hurokba az előfeltétel mellett.
3. Hogyan ábrázolja a 3.42. Ábrán látható algoritmust?
A 3.42. Ábra egy algoritmus egy töredékét szemlélteti, amelyben a teljes elágazás be van ágyazva egy hurokba egy számlálóval, és a 3.43. Ábra egy algoritmus egy olyan részletét, amelyben a teljes elágazás be van fészkelve egy hurokba egy elõfeltételtel.
5. Hogyan ábrázolja a 3.44. Ábrán látható algoritmust?
6. Hogyan ábrázolja a 3.45. Ábrán látható algoritmust?
A 3.44. És a 3.45. Ábrán bemutatott algoritmusok töredékeiben a ciklust akkor hajtják végre, ha az ág állapotának ellenőrzésének eredménye Igen. Hasonlóképpen, egy hurok átalakulhat ágakba, így fut, ha az ág állapotának ellenőrzésének eredménye Nincs. A teljes elágazási ciklusok beléphetnek úgy is, hogy egyikük akkor kerül végrehajtásra, ha az elágazási állapot ellenőrzésének eredménye Igen, a másik pedig akkor, ha az elágazási feltétel ellenőrzésének eredménye Nem. Vegye figyelembe, hogy a hurkok nemcsak a teljes ágakban, hanem a hiányos elágazásokban is beágyazhatók.
Якщо помітили в тексті помилку, виділіть її та натисніть Ctrl + Enter